Weatherproofing involves numerous crucial components. Here's an extensive list:
1. Seals and Gaskets
Function: Seals and gaskets are essential for blocking air and water leaks. They provide a tight fit in between the door and frame.
Type of SealDescriptionCompression SealsMade from rubber or sponge materials, compress to form a barrierWeather StrippingFlexible product that blocks air spaces around the doorThreshold SealsInstalled at the bottom of the door to prevent water ingress2. Appropriate Installation
Function: Ensuring your UPVC door is installed properly is crucial. An improperly fitted door can result in air and water leakages.
Setup AspectSignificanceLevelingAn unequal setup can trigger spacesAlignmentMisalignment affects sealing efficiencyProtectingProper fixing decreases motion and wear3. Maintenance and Regular Checks
Function: Regular maintenance extends the lifespan of UPVC Door Service doors while guaranteeing they remain weatherproof.
Maintenance TaskFrequencyPurposeInspect SealsEvery 6 monthsCheck for wear and replace as requiredCleaningMonthlyPrevent dirt accumulation that can degrade sealsLube HingesTwo times a yearEnsure smooth operation and decrease use4. Additional Weatherproofing Products
Function: Consider utilizing extra items to improve the weather strength of your UPVC doors.
ItemUseDoor CanopiesProtects from direct rain and sun direct exposureWeatherproof PaintA protective layer that adds sturdinessInsulated PanelsImproves thermal effectivenessDIY Weatherproofing Techniques
Property owners might wish to undertake some weatherproofing determines themselves. Here are some DIY pointers:
Inspect and Replace Seals: Check for gaps and change any damaged seals.Change Hinges: Ensure hinges are correctly lined up and tightened.Apply Weather Stripping: Add or change weather condition removing as needed.Use a Door Sweep: Install a door sweep at the bottom to block water and drafts.FAQs About UPVC Door Weatherproofing1. How frequently should I inspect my UPVC door seals?
It is suggested to inspect your UPVC door seals every six months. This guarantees any wear is addressed immediately, avoiding prospective leakages.
2. Can I increase the insulation of my UPVC door?
Yes, you can increase insulation by including insulated panels or using weatherproof paint specifically created for UPVC.
3. What is the typical life-span of a UPVC door?
A well-maintained UPVC Door Fixing door can last anywhere from 20 to 30 years, depending on the quality and direct exposure to elements.
4. Are UPVC doors resistant to extreme weather?
UPVC doors are created to stand up to various climate condition, however proper weatherproofing more enhances their strength against extreme weather.
5. Should I work with a professional for installation and weatherproofing?
While some elements can be DIY jobs, working with specialists may guarantee that installation and weatherproofing are done properly, maximizing efficiency.
